Analysis
Lithuania recorded 287 1000 USD for china —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— export value in 2018.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 7.1% on the previous year and up 245.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, china —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— export value in Lithuania peaked at 325 1000 USD in 2016 and was at its lowest, 58 1000 USD, in 2006.
Lithuania ranks 51st of 73 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 13 years of available data.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
